## Deploying the Gatewick Proctor Queue

Deploys are pretty painless: push to main, wait for the pipeline, then watch the queue drain dashboard for five minutes. If candidates pile up mid-exam, roll back first and ask questions later — the queue replays safely. Everything the workers care about lives in one config block, shown here for reference.

settings of bafof-yagef:
JOROX_PIN=8740
JOROX_TENANT=pelox
JOROX_METRICS_HOST=metrics.jorox.qorvelworks.internal
JOROX_SEAL=seal_c78f63c1
JOROX_STANDBY_TEAM=norax

# Service Accounts for Health Checks

If your plugin sits behind the Bramblegate load balancer, you'll need a service account so the `/healthz` probes don't get bounced by auth. Probes run every ten seconds, so keep your handler cheap. Register your plugin name in the Hutch console, then use the shared probe key below when wiring up the checker.

gateway credential: kto23_dolYgAScEh2TaPOlStqOl98

Title: Stale static-analysis baseline blocking Fernwick 4.2 cut

Hey — the lint baseline file in Fernwick's repo hasn't been regenerated since the parser swap, so CI flags ~300 pre-existing warnings as new. Nothing's actually broken; we just need the baseline refreshed before the release branch is cut. Tomas regenerated it locally and it's clean under the trace below.

trace token, kahog-tajeg: htk6_97d963